Perched above Wahweap Bay, Wahweap Overlook is a paved vantage in Glen Canyon NRA. From this land-side viewpoint you can take in a broad panorama that stretches across Lake Powell toward the distant shoreline. The overlook sits near Page, Arizona, and offers a convenient stop during a day of lake-country exploring. The scene changes with the light and the seasons, inviting a relaxed, unrushed visit.
Overview and Sights
From the paved pullout, you see Wahweap Bay and the lake beyond.
Look for Castle Rock to frame the broad panorama, with the marina visible in the distance.
